In order to assess the environmental impact of electric bikes, it is crucial to consider the lifecycle emissions. These are the emissions that the vehicle emits into the atmosphere over its lifetime. This involves analysing the vehicle's production, usage, energy production process and then disposal.
The production process of a car involves the extraction of raw materials and their extraction and the manufacturing of components and then the assembly of the final product. Although less enviro-friendly than the manufacturing of a vehicle, this still requires a significant amount of energy. This is among the major contributors to the carbon footprint of scooters.
When your scooter reaches the end of its useful lifespan it should be properly disposed of. This includes reclaiming any parts that can be reused, and recycling the remaining components. This is especially crucial for lithium-ion batteries, which contain dangerous materials that can be released into the environment if they are not disposed of properly. green power electric mobility scooter are looking into closed loop recycling methods where old scooter batteries can be recycled to make new batteries, reducing the necessity for extraction of raw materials and avoiding potential environmental damage.
Electric scooters can drastically reduce emissions and aid in the creation of a more sustainable transport system. They provide an alternative to cars and public transport for short journeys and help curb traffic congestion and improve air quality. However, they are able to contribute significantly to decarbonisation only if the electricity they consume comes from renewable sources.
As battery technology advances cost reductions are reduced and charging infrastructure is expanding scooters are set to play a significant role in urban transport. By cutting down on emissions, congestion in traffic and improving air quality, these nimble, flexible vehicles offer a solution to a variety of pressing environmental issues.

Battery technology for electric scooters continues to improve, allowing more durable and green batteries. There are additional environmental concerns to be addressed, such as the energy needed for the manufacturing of the battery and its disposal at the end of its lifespan. Furthermore, the user can make better daily choices to help lower their energy consumption and environmental footprint by maintaining the proper tire pressure, avoiding excessive acceleration, and choosing short and direct trips.
